431. Deputy Catherine Connolly asked the Minister for Finance the reason the stamp duty levy on privately funded pension schemes introduced as a temporary measure in 2011 is still being levied on IASS pensioners particularly in view of the deep cuts in their pensions that these pensioners suffered following the revision of pensions legislation in 2013 and 2014;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[14092/21]
